Admission Snapshot
Typical admitted student: A bachelor's degree in engineering, computer science, or a related field with a minimum GPA of 3.0 is required, along with coursework in programming, linear algebra, and calculus. Relevant experience in AI, robotics, or machine learning is preferred.
About This Program
This interdisciplinary graduate program, offered through a joint collaboration of three engineering departments, provides advanced training in the design, operation, and control of robotic systems. Coursework concentrates on Machine Learning and AI Engineering / Applied AI. Most students complete it in about 1.33 years.
Graduates frequently move into roles such as Robotics Engineer, with reported salaries around $120,000.

What You'll Learn
- Design AI algorithms for robotic perception and decision-making.
- Implement computer vision techniques for object recognition and scene understanding.
- Develop motion planning and control systems using machine learning.
- Apply deep learning models to real-time robotic sensing and localization.
Curriculum Highlights
The program consists of core courses in robotics planning, sensing, and navigation, with a specialized focus area in artificial intelligence and perception that includes computer vision.

Admissions
Admission to University of California, Riverside's Master's in Robotics - Artificial Intelligence and Perception generally expects a bachelor's degree. The GRE is optional here β a growing norm among AI programs β so applicants can often lead with coursework, projects and recommendations instead. Deadlines, testing policies and funding change year to year, so confirm the current requirements on the official program page before applying.
Application Materials
- Statement of Purpose: Required
- Letters of Recommendation: 3
- Resume: Required
- Transcripts: Official transcripts required
